Ballet Jorgen Canada dancers will be hosting “Dance for Japan”, a performance to raise funds for the earthquake relief in Japan.

The performance will be held on Friday, March 25, 2011 at 7:00 pm at George Brown College, 160 Kendal – Ballet Jorgen Studios (Casa Loma).

Admission is by donation and all proceeds will go to the Canadian Red Cross for relief efforts in Japan.

Commercial Dance Studies Program is First of Its Kind

George Brown Dance is offering a new three-semester certificate program in Commercial Dance Studies. It is the first college level, certified program in Canada offering training for dancers in the commercial field.

The program is designed for students with training in contemporary dance forms, specifically jazz, hip hop and musical theatre. Commercial Dance Studies will prepare dancers for a careers in film, television, music videos and touring, musical theatre, cruise ship and resort entertainment, and industrial productions.
